Hi,

 

I sailed Galaxy, Rome to Rome, this August. We booked our flight out the next day. I think anyone would hesitate to answer you b/c there are things that can delay you. You don't say how you are getting to the airport. I think the airport is probably at least an hour from the port (although, we did not make this drive so I cannot be sure) but find out for sure. I can tell you for our August disembarkation, it was a breeze. I could not believe how easy it was (b/c I have read many, many stories about how long this can take). They called us in groups (we were in the cheepo cabins on level 5). We left the ship at 7:30 and they bussed us to a site where we could pick up our bags. The night before they gave us colored tags to attach to our bags so that's how they grouped them. We found our bags EASILY. So I would say we were ready to leave port by 8:15 (maybe a bit earlier). It's hard to say what time your group will leave the ship since that seems to be dependent on where your cabin is (just an assumption). Also, you may have something else go wrong.

 

Even with the good experience I had, I personally would not book a flight that early b/c you have to be there by 10:00 for check in in International Flights and you have no room for error. It's better to save the FF miles for later and pay for a ticket that will not be stressful and that you know you will be able to use.

The airport is at least an hour's drive from the port. Security in Rome is very tight, and it takes a while to get through it. There were at least 3 checkpoints the last time we flew out of Rome. I don't think you will make a noon flight on the same day. Better to take an evening flight, or book a flight for the next day.

This is the service is listed below. If you can fit in a car with all of your luggage it was 110 Euro each way plus a small tip. The luggage has to fit in the trunk.We stayed in Rome before and after the cruise. If you need a minivan it was 140 euro. The service was very reliable, the mini vans were new and clean. We used them 4 times. Airport to hotel, hotel to port, port to hotel, hotel to airport. On time every time. It was 45 euro each way for the airport. Only one of the four drivers spoke english. We did every thing by e-mail. It only took us about an hour to get to the port from Rome. It is probably about and hour and 15 minutes from the airport. It takes about 20 minutes to get your luggage. We went through immigratin in Germany. The italians didn't even look at us. We walked right through with out luggage.

I have flown out of Rome back to the US after 4 cruises and I feel the Rome Airport is one of the toughest to get through in a short amount of time. There are at least 3 security checks and long lines for each of those. Unless you're flying first class/business class, the lines for check in can get very long and can take more than 45 minutes just waiting in line. You also have to go through Immigration, and if it's a busy time, those lines can be long also. I usually fly Delta and they have flights that leave Rome in the mid-afternoon, and fly to JFK. It's about an hour to get to DaVinci Airport barring any traffic problems.

The morning we arrived in Rome, so did 2 or 3 other ships, one of those being the QM2. It was taking almost 2 hours to get to Rome due to traffic backups. There was a mixup and our car didn't arrive to pick us up. (2 people from different countries with the same name on the same ship using the same limo company). Theirs arrived and ours didn't. Anyway, we finally found a cab driver who was willing to take us to Rome for a set fee that was not highly overpriced. He said we didn't lose much time because the roads were so congested that most people spent the 2 hours sitting in traffic instead of sitting on the dock waiting like we did. BTW, we had confirmed our pick-up time before we left on the cruise and was assured they would be there. Also, there are no phones available at the dock and the dock workers are not helpful at all. Make sure you have your arrangements lined up or you are basically stuck until people start arriving for the next sailing. We just got lucky. We were VERY glad we had decided to fly out the next day. That took a lot of pressure off. We were only concerned about getting back to Rome in time to tour the Vatican, which we did with time to spare.

I thought I would post back here now that we have returned. I know the flight time issue was a major concern for us.

 

Overall, an 11:50 flight gave us MORE than enough time to make it from the ship in Civi. to the airport. The Galaxy docked around 4:45AM, I think you could be off the ship by 5:45AM. We got off at 6:15 and waited around for our taxi driver unitl 8 am. (I had booked him at 7:30 thinking we couldn't get off until then). We were at the airport by 9. Air France only lets you check in 2 hours early, so we had to wait to check in. We made it to our gate two hours early.

 

If I had to do it again, I might even try to get an earlier flight. There was a lot of waiting involved leaving at noon. A 10Am flight would be perfect, but then I would worry that the ship might be late getting in.

We recently returned from the June 3 10 night cruise. Galaxy docked at 4am. Some table companions of ours were booked by Celebrity on a 10.10am Delta flight and were given a 5.45am disembarkation time. We had a 6.15am time slot and left absolutely on time. The coach took less than an hour to Rome Airport. Our flight wasn't until noon and for some reason Rome Airport won't let you check in more than three hours before your flight so we had to kick our heels for an hour or so. The last disembarkation time was listed as 9.30am.
